Street fighting legend turned MMA ratings sensation Kimbo Slice, 42, died Monday night after being hospitalized for undisclosed reasons.

Slice, real name Kevin Ferguson, was a street fighting legend in the early-to-mid 2000s and a true rags-to-riches story, going from fighting in backyards in Miami to on high-profile mixed martial arts cards across multiple promotions.

His sudden passing was a shock to his peers and legions of fans, and those both inside and outside the fight community took to social media to offer condolences to his family and friends.
